The People’s Democratic Party (PDP) in Ekiti State has described as ridiculous and unexplainable the closure of all primary and secondary schools in the State by the governor, Dr Kayode Fayemi over the ongoing 2021 National Festival of Arts and Culture (NAFEST)
The PDP publicity secretary, Raphael Adeyanju in a statement after an emergency State Working Committee (SWC) meeting presided over by the acting chairman, Lanre Omolase at the weekend noted that the action of the All Progressives Congress-led government was antithetical to the development of education in the state.
The state party said, “While we are not against the celebration of our culture and tradition, it is unexplainable that a government who goes about claiming to be restoring our values in Ekiti could close schools for two weeks just because the State is holding NAFEST.
It lamented that education, which is the pride of Ekiti and its people,” has been sacrificed for a mere festival of arts and culture by the APC government ostensibly because Governor Fayemi and his party do not value education.”
“Up till now, we are still unable to fathom out the reason any government will close primary and secondary schools, including private ones for two weeks simply because Festival of Arts and Culture is holding in the State capital.
“Here in Ekiti, pupils were simply told to stay at home until further notice with no explanation from anyone.
“In all these, what we have seen is a clear misplaced priority on the side of a party and government that do not care about the future of Ekiti children and by the power of God, just like all the afflictions of the Israelites, this phase too shall pass next year,” the statement read.
However, the APC state publicity secretary, Segun Dipe, said the one- week vacation was declared to prevent students from sneaking out of schools, by being attracted by the festival, observe their midterm and prevent students cohabiting with strangers, who are presently occupying some hostels owned by public schools.
Dipe, who described the vituperation as unreasonable and belated, said no governor could have loved education like Fayemi, who declared free education in primary and secondary schools and abrogated the levy allegedly imposed on pupils by the immediate past PDP administration.
The APC spokesperson, insisted that Fayemi has not committed any crime for declaring the holiday for students .
“Let me remind the PDP that the holiday was declared to prevent students from sneaking out of schools to go and watch the cultural fiesta. But if they are under the custody of their parents, nothing of such would happen. Again, it is also a time for them to observe their midterm holidays, having got to the middle of the first term.
“How can they expect visitors to be cohabiting with students in hostels? Because the contingents are using the school hostels. There was no governor that has been education-friendly like Governor Fayemi. He was the one that removed the pupils out of tax net. These show that the governor is a caring leader.
“We all know the economic value of NAFEST. It Marvels me that the PDP could be talking now after the expiration of the vacation. For Fayemi’s love for education, school enrolment has gone up, teachers’ salaries are paid regularly, they can access loans easily and they are given incentives like trainings and workshops to sharpen their performances.”
